Sugar Snap Pea Salad with Radishes Feta and Arugula

Sugar Snap Pea Salad


  • Author: Recipe Inspire
  • Total Time: 15 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

This Sugar Snap Pea Salad is crisp, fresh, and full of bright flavor. Made with crunchy snap peas, a light lemon dressing, and simple add-ins, it’s the perfect spring or summer side dish.


Ingredients

Scale

Ingredients

  • 4 cups sugar snap peas, trimmed and thinly sliced
  • 1/4 cup thinly sliced red onion
  • 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h mint
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on honey
  • Salt and black pepper to taste

Instructions

Instructions

  1. Prep peas: Rinse and trim sugar snap peas. Slice thinly on a diagonal.
  2. Make dressing: In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, honey, salt, and pepper.
  3. Combine: In a large bowl, toss snap peas, red onion, mint, and parsley.
  4. Add dressing: Pour dressing over salad and toss to coat evenly.
  5. Finish: Sprinkle with crumbled feta before serving.
  6. Chill (optional): Refrigerate for 15–20 minutes to allow flavors to blend.

Notes

For extra crunch, add toasted almonds or sunflower seeds. This salad is best enjoyed the same day for maximum freshness.
